Nobody has been injured after an explosion of a major pipeline near the village of Nedan just a few km from Pavlikeni in north central Bulgaria, officials say.
Local authorities report it is not known what caused the blast.
Following the explosion, a fire broke out near the pipeline that is now being extinguished.
Bulgarian Prime Minister Boyko Borisov told private national NOVA TV station on Friday morning that an inspection would be carried out by the national security agency DANS to establish whether it was an act of sabotage.
